“Never Again-Too "Smelly"”
2 of 5 stars Reviewed 24 February 2011
5
people found this review helpful

The only things good about this hotel were the internet service and the comfort of the bed. As a diamond member, since the hotel wasn't full, I thought when I checked in that I would be asked if I wanted an upgrade. That did not happen. My room smelled and there was a red stain on the carpet by the bathroom entrance, which to me looked like blood. The room had a terrible odor so fortunately I was able to open the window to air it out. . I called the front desk several times to ask about a room service menu. Finally someone answered the 4th time and told me the restaurant is closed, which I found out later was due to the owner passing away. Still, they should post it on the website and tell people when they check in. One of the reasons I decided to try this hotel was because of the restaurant reviews. I had traveled all day and didn't want to go out after I checked in. I ended up trying a chicken place that delivered and although it was ok, it wasn't great. The parking lot is behind the hotel, down a slope that was icy and full of snow The hallways smell, the room smelled, just very smelly!

“Pleasantly Surprised, Highly Recommended for budget-minded families”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 21 February 2010

For an under $75/night hotel, we were pleasantly surprised with the Woodsview. If you are on a tight budget and want a nice, clean, no-frills place to stay, this hotel is highly recommended by us. The indoor pool and hot tub are shared with the apartment complex next door, but the pool area is exceptionally clean and well cared for. The hotel staff was very friendly and eager to please. The rooms are not fancy, but were well cared for and clean.

If you want a nice meal withou leaving the premises, the restaurant/lounge on the lower level serves a great meal. We were initially put off by the appearance of the place, but we are glad we decided to stay. I had the KC Strip, and my husband had the Fried perch. Our 3yo son had chicken noodle soup. We all had more food than we could eat and it was very good. The staff here was exceptionally friendly as well, and made sure we were pleased with our meals.

Once registered, the parking is located behind the motel and you re-enter through a lower level entrance that looks like a service entrance but it is much more convenient than walking back around to the main lobby.

Overall, if you are expecting a newer hotel with fancy rooms, this is probably not the place for you.... But, if you want a nice place to stay and don't mind an older hotel that has been well-maintained and is clean, then go ahead and try out the Woodsview Inn.

“Absolutely Perfect for Baseball Fans”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ed 19 July 2009
3
people found this review helpful

My friends and I chose to stay at the Woods View Inn due to its proximity to Miller Park. We knew beforehand that other than Miller Park, there really wasn't anything else in the vicinity of the hotel, and that the hotel wasn't in the ritziest area. We weren't really expecting too much, but we did get more than we had expected. The staff were absolutely AMAZING throughout our two-night stay. The room we had was a bit more spacious than we had expected. Having a little kitchen area complete with an oven, fridge, and microwave was an added bonus, even though we weren't able to use them during our short stay. The continental breakfast that was included was nothing to rave about, but the complimentary toast, baked goods, yogurt, fruit salad, hard boiled eggs, cereal and oatmeal were more than adequate for our needs.

There's a restaurant/bar attached to the hotel, but we didn't have the chance to try it because food isn't served after 9pm.

The hotel's about a 20-minute walk from Miller Park, and they provide easy directions at front desk. The walk is actually a nice walk, and very safe. But other than Miller Park, there really isn't anything around. There's a couple of bars (which were packed so we didn't go in) and we were able to walk to a Walgreen's and a Taco Bell. So this hotel probably isn't the best choice if you want to see the city, unless you're willing to drive.

The only negatives we experienced were that the beds were a bit too hard for our comfort level, the walls are somewhat thin (but we weren't disrupted at night), and the elevator is definitely not for the claustrophobic (luckily we were on the 2nd floor so we didn't really have to use it). But the negatives really didn't affect us at all.

We will definitely be staying here the next time we head to Milwaukee for Brewers games.

“NICE & CONVENIENT HOTEL”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 1 July 2009

We stayed at this hotel because of the location near Miller Park in Milwaukee. Reviews had stated you could take a 15 minute walk to Miller Park and this was what we were looking for. The hotel was only a couple stop lights off of the freeway, easy access to/from. Our room was clean, more than adequate, great pillows and nice staff. We also took advantage of the "lounge" they had in the basement of the hotel--the food was good and we had a fun time while there. Our kids enjoyed the pool and exercise room. Because of where our room was located, the walls weren't as 'thick' and soundproof as we'd liked but we made due. The walk to Miller Park was very easy and safe and they even have a little map showing you directions. It was great and we'd certainly stay here again, especially when attending a Brewer game!!
